Rotterdam man dies in police custody

A 40-year-old man died in Rotterdam early Wednesday morning after being arrested by the police. The healthcare institution where the man was housed had called the police because he was causing problems there, a police report said.. When the police arrived at the facility, staff already had the man under control, Dutch authorities claimed.

His condition worsened shortly after the police cuffed him and took him away. The officers then tried to resuscitate the man and he was rushed to the hospital, where he died at about 1 a.m.

The cause of death is not yet known. The Rijksrecherche, the department that handles internal investigations at the police, is investigating, police said.
